toyota-logo-2020.pngTransponder Keys

Transponder keys differ from regular keys because they are equipped with an embedded chip which communicates with the computer system of the car. This helps prevent theft by preventing a key from activating a car until it's within range of the vehicle's radio antenna with a ring. If you've lost your transponder's key, it is essential to locate a professional to duplicate or replace it. The cost of purchasing a new transponder keys is contingent on the make and model of car you drive, as well as what kind of key you used to have. For example, you may have a FOBIK chip key or a remote flip key or a smart keys with emergency metal blade. It is essential to know the difference between these types of keys before deciding to purchase one.

If you own a Fobik chip key, it will need to be programmed before it can be used to start the vehicle. This is usually done by an auto dealership or locksmith.

Most modern car keys use a special type of battery that is usually lithium-ion. These batteries are long-lasting however they will eventually have to be changed. There are replacement batteries in a wide range of hardware stores as well as big-box retailers, or a specialist auto parts store. It is recommended to replace batteries when you notice that they're not holding charge or are fading in the color. You can also consult the owner's manual or the Internet for further instructions.

It's simple to change the battery on the Nissan Smart Key, but you should always wear gloves when working with sensitive electronic components. It's recommended to wear gloves made of latex or nonlatex. You'll also need a screwdriver. Also, ensure that you have the right type of 3V CR2032 battery. This can be found in multipacks at stores like Home Depot and Walmart for less than $5 USD.
